Apple Bananasauce
Created as a use for over-ripe bananas, Apple Bananasauce has become a beloved dessert, snack, even breakfast parfaited with Greek yogurt.
Yield: 4 servings (about ¾ cup)

Instructions
Step 1
Place the apples in the bowl of a food processor fitted with a steel blade and process until they are well chopped. Scrape down the sides of the bowl and add the banana and cinnamon. Process until smooth. Transfer to a bowl, cover and refrigerate at least one and up to four hours.
